Given a triangular pyramid and triangular prism with congruent bases and the same heights, what do you know about the relationship between the volume of each? Write your answer in fraction form?

The volume of a triangular pyramid is one-third the volume of a triangular prism with congruent bases and the same height.

In fraction form, this relationship can be expressed as:

Volume of triangular pyramid / Volume of triangular prism = 1/3
